Asp进阶秘籍:服务器开发核心实战技巧深度剖析

Asp(Active Server Pages)作为早期的服务器端脚本技术,虽然在现代开发中逐渐被更先进的框架所取代,但在某些遗留系统或特定场景下仍然具有重要价值。掌握Asp进阶技巧,能够显著提升服务器端开发效率与代码质量。

AI生成结论图,仅供参考

在Asp开发中,合理使用组件和对象是关键。通过创建自定义组件,可以将重复逻辑封装,提高代码复用性。例如,利用Server.CreateObject方法调用ADO对象进行数据库操作,能有效简化数据访问流程。

性能优化同样不可忽视。避免在页面中频繁执行数据库查询,合理使用缓存机制,如Response.Cache设置,可减少服务器负载。•减少不必要的HTML输出,有助于加快页面响应速度。

安全性方面,应注重输入验证和错误处理。对用户提交的数据进行严格过滤,防止SQL注入等攻击。同时,关闭调试信息输出,避免暴露敏感内容。

•良好的代码结构和注释习惯能提升团队协作效率。将业务逻辑与页面展示分离,采用模块化设计,使代码更易维护和扩展。

dawei

【声明】:蚌埠站长网内容转载自互联网,其相关言论仅代表作者个人观点绝非权威,不代表本站立场。如您发现内容存在版权问题,请提交相关链接至邮箱:bqsm@foxmail.com,我们将及时予以处理。